Hidradenitis Suppurativa market is expected to grow with increasing awareness, early diagnosis, and access to treatments. Biologic and targeted therapies like IL-17 and JAK inhibitors are reshaping the therapeutic landscape, providing hope for patients. The market shows high potential for innovation and growth due to rising prevalence and unmet clinical needs.

The Hidradenitis Suppurativa pipeline report reveals a robust space with 24+ active companies developing 26+ drugs. Notable players include InflaRx, MoonLake TX, Incyte Corporation, and more. Promising therapies like Sonelokimab, INCB54707, and Brivekimig are in different trial phases, offering hope for improved treatment options.
Recent developments in Hidradenitis Suppurativa treatment space include positive results from trials of Sonelokimab and Brivekimig, launches of new studies like TibuSHIELD, and successful trials of drugs like povorcitinib.
